摘要:为满足小型全自动生化分析仪系统的多任务、高实时性以及数据运算复杂等要求,提出了一种基于ARM-双单片机系统的设计方法。该系统采用S3C2440A(ARM)为上位机、C8051F060单片机为下位机的系统架构,ARM与单片机之间采用串口通信方式。ARM负责任务分配和数据存贮,主单片机负责试剂盘的定位和数据采集,从单片机负责加样臂的旋转和样品加样,实现了多任务并行快速处理;系统采用嵌入式Linux和QT/E(QT/Embedded)开发软件。试验结果表明,系统具有运动控制实时性好、运算处理能力强和性能稳定可靠等优点,完全满足实际应用的需求。
关键词:arm 双单片机系统 嵌入式linux 串口通信 c8051f060
单位:长春理工大学机电工程学院 吉林长春130028 中国科学院长春光学精密机械与物理研究所 吉林长春130033
注:因版权方要求,不能公开全文,如需全文,请咨询杂志社